一佳互联

展开菜单

配置logstash从redis读取filebeat收集的日志(上)

配置logstash从redis读取filebeat收集的日志(上)
logstash读取redis缓存日志 1.logstash从redis读取收集日志原理 常规的日志收集方式都是由filebeat收集完直接输出给es集群,如果当后端应用访问量大,产生的日志也特别巨大,这时再由filebeat收集日志直接传输给es,会给es带来特别大的压力,如果es这时挂掉,filebeat依然在收集日志,这时filebeat找不到es集群,则会把收集来的日志丢弃 针对日志量大的问题可以在es集...

优化logstash从redis中读取日志的配置(下)

优化logstash从redis中读取日志的配置(下)
优化logstash读取redis缓存日志配置 紧接着配置logstash从redis读取filebeat收集的日志(上) 进一步优化 1.优化配置思路 之前的logstash读取redis收集来的日志数据配置需要很多步骤,每次新加一个日志都特别繁琐 没有优化前新增一个日志收集的配置步骤: ​ 1.配置filebeat收集什么日志,增加标签 ​ 2.配置filebeat将日志存储到哪里 ​...

ELK日志系统终极架构

ELK日志系统终极架构
ELK终极架构 ELK终极架构 ELK终极架构 1.ELK终极架构图 2.部署终极ELK架构 2.2.部署两台redis 2.3.配置nginx四层负载均衡 2.4.配置keepalived高可用 2.5.挂掉redis01查看是否会切换到redis0...

Prometheus+Grafana监控系统配合Cadvisor监控Docker容器

Prometheus+Grafana监控系统配合Cadvisor监控Docker容器
prometheus使用cadvisor监控docker容器 1.cadvisor概述 一般公司会有很多docker主机,那么就需要对docker进行监控了,docker监控可以采用docker stats配合shell命令来取值做监控,但是无法传递给prometheus进行采集,zabbix监控docker又比较麻烦,因此就有了谷歌的cadvisor cadvisor不仅可以搜集一台机器上的所有运行的容器信息,...

HIVE 配置文件详解

HIVE 配置文件详解
hive的配置: hive.ddl.output.format:hive的ddl语句的输出格式,默认是text,纯文本,还有json格式,这个是0.90以后才出的新配置; hive.exec.script.wrapper:hive调用脚本时的包装器,默认是null,如果设置为python的话,那么在做脚本调用操作时语句会变为python <script command>,null的话就是直接执行<script command>; hi...

zookeeper的配置参数详解(zoo.cfg)

zookeeper的配置参数详解(zoo.cfg)
配置参数详解(主要是%ZOOKEEPER_HOME%/conf/zoo.cfg文件)   参数名 说明 clientPort 客户端连接server的端口,即对外服务端口,一般设置为2181吧。 dataDir 存储快照文件snapshot的目录。默认情况下,事务日志也会存储在这里。建议同时配置参数dataLogDir, 事务日志的写性能直接影响zk性能。 tickTime...

Zookeeper 扫盲 :disappointed_relieved:

Zookeeper 扫盲 :disappointed_relieved:
配置文件详解: tickTime:基本事件单元,以毫秒为单位,这个时间作为 Zookeeper 服务器之间或客户端之间维持心跳的时间间隔 dataDir:存储内存中数据库快照的位置,顾名思义就是 Zookeeper 保存数据的目录,默认情况下,Zookeeper 将写数据的日志文件也保存到这个目录里 clientPort:这个端口就是客户端连接 Zookeeper 服务器的端口,Zookeeper 会监听这个端口,接受客户端的访问请求 initLimit:这个配置...

livy-0.5安装

livy-0.5安装
$ cat conf/livy-env.sh #!/usr/bin/env bash SPARK_HOME=/opt/spark HADOOP_CONF_DIR=/etc/hadoop/conf $ cat conf/livy.conf livy.server.session.factory = yarn livy.spark.master = yarn-client livy.impersonation.enabled = true livy.repl.enable...